RSA is an asymmetric cryptographic algorithm used for secure communication. It involves a pair of keys: a public key for encryption and a private key for decryption. The security of RSA is based on the difficulty of factoring large composite numbers into their prime factors. The algorithm's strength lies in its ability to ensure that only the intended recipient, with the corresponding private key, can access the encrypted information.
